#956904 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#956904 is composed of 58.4% red, 41.2% green and 1.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 29.5% magenta, 97.3% yellow and 41.6% black. It has a hue angle of 41.8 degrees, a saturation of 94.8% and a lightness of 30%. #956904 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d208 with #2b0000. Closest websafe color is: #996600.

Shades and Tints of #956904
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0b00 is the darkest color, while #fffefb is the lightest one.
